Abstract
O 6-Benzylguanine is an irreversible inactivator of O 6-alkylguanine-DNA alkyltransferase currently in clinical trials to overcome alkyltransferase-mediated resistance to certain cancer chemotherapeutic alkylating agents. In order to produce more soluble alkyltransferase inhibitors, we have synthesized three aminomethyl-substituted O 6-benzylguanines and the three methyl analogs and found that the substitution of aminomethyl at the meta-position ...
